I use Alternative Ivory.
Machines well, glues well with CA.
Has translucent grains like Ivory, white when first cut, turns slightly(very slightly) creamy, I'm not sure if it's the finish or ultavoilot light.
Cross section looks like marbling, that's the sure way of knowing it's not real.

Forgot to tell you, if you want the ivory grain pattern to show, you have to cut your inlays from the radial face. The axial face is the cross section and will have a like cream marbling look.

I have tried the Alternative Ivory and the Faux Ivory, and prefer the machining and gluing qualities of the Faux Ivory. I also tried subjecting the Faux Ivory to cold and hot temperatures and it shrank and swelled almost identically to the Hard Maple in the test. The Alternative Ivory seems to be a little harder, but when subjected to extreme shock the Alternative Ivory will fracture and the Faux Ivory dents.
